Cal State Long Beach vs. InterCoast Colleges-West Covina
Both California State University-Long Beach and InterCoast Colleges-West Covina are 4 years schools located in California. The following statements compare California State University-Long Beach and InterCoast Colleges-West Covina with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
- InterCoast Colleges-West Covina's tuition ($24,600) is more expensive than Cal State Long Beach ($19,974).

- InterCoast Colleges-West Covina's students to faculty ratio (15 to 1) is lower than Cal State Long Beach (23 to 1).
- Cal State Long Beach (42,003 students) is larger than InterCoast Colleges-West Covina (535 students) with more enrolled students.
- Cal State Long Beach ($11,350) has higher amount of financial aid than InterCoast Colleges-West Covina ($10,687).
- InterCoast Colleges-West Covina's graduation rate (97%) is higher than Cal State Long Beach (69%).
